How Roots Intrude and Affect Drains

Roots from nearby trees and shrubs often seek moist environments, making drainage systems an appealing target. As they push through small cracks or joints in pipes, they can cause significant blockages and reduce the flow of wastewater. This intrusion can lead to water pooling in sinks and bathtubs, creating unpleasant odours that permeate the home.

Once roots establish themselves in the drainage system, they begin to absorb nutrients and organic matter that accumulate within the pipes. This can result in further decomposition, releasing foul-smelling gases such as hydrogen sulphide. Over time, these situations can exacerbate, necessitating professional intervention to remove the invasive roots and restore proper function to the drains.

Accumulation of Soap Scum

Soap scum is a common byproduct of using soaps and detergents that contain fats and oils. When these substances mix with minerals found in hard water, they create a sticky residue that can accumulate over time within the plumbing system. This buildup not only reduces the efficiency of the drainage system but can also trap food particles and organic matter, leading to further blockages and unpleasant odours.

The presence of soap scum can exacerbate existing issues in drains, particularly when combined with other organic waste. Regular maintenance, including periodic cleaning and the use of natural remedies such as vinegar and baking soda, can help mitigate this problem. Paying attention to the materials used in personal care products can also make a significant difference in reducing soap scum accumulation, contributing to a healthier drain system overall.

Improper Use of Drain Cleaners

Many people turn to chemical drain cleaners as a quick fix for clogged pipes. These products can offer immediate relief, but their improper use often leads to more significant issues. Pouring too much cleaner down the drain or using it too frequently can result in damage to the plumbing system. The harsh chemicals may corrode pipes over time, causing leaks and other complications that require costly repairs.

Additionally, the use of strong chemical cleaners can have negative environmental impacts. When rinsed away, these toxic substances can contaminate waterways and harm local ecosystems. As a result, relying on chemical solutions might seem convenient initially, but it poses risks that extend beyond the household. Alternative methods for clearing drains should be considered to maintain both plumbing integrity and environmental safety.

Hard Water Deposits

The presence of hard water can lead to significant mineral buildup in plumbing systems. This accumulation typically features calcium and magnesium deposits that adhere to the surfaces of pipes. Over time, these deposits can restrict water flow and create an environment conducive to foul odours. When blockages occur, stagnant water often becomes a breeding ground for bacteria, exacerbating unpleasant smells.

Cleaning hard water deposits requires diligent maintenance. Regular descaling can prevent the worst effects of mineral buildup and keep drains functioning properly. Using a mixture of vinegar and baking soda is a natural remedy to break down these deposits. Additionally, investing in a water softener may provide a long-term solution to minimise hard water issues at the source.

Neglecting Traps

Drain traps play a vital role in preventing unwanted odours from entering living spaces. These U-shaped sections of pipe hold a small amount of water, creating a seal that stops sewer gases from escaping. Over time, however, traps can become neglected due to lack of cleaning or maintenance. When this happens, they can accumulate debris, food particles, and even hair, which can lead to foul smells emanating from the drains.

Additionally, if a trap loses its water seal due to evaporation or improper installation, the protective barrier is compromised. As a result, not only do unpleasant odours make their way into homes, but the risk of blockages increases significantly. Regular inspection and cleaning of drain traps can help maintain their function and ensure that homes remain free from dank smells that can sometimes linger.

Seasonal Changes

As the seasons change, fluctuations in temperature and moisture levels can significantly impact the condition of drains. During colder months, water in pipes may freeze, leading to potential blockages when it thaws. Conversely, heavy rains in spring and summer can overwhelm drainage systems, causing overflows and prompting unpleasant odours from stagnant water trapped in pipes.

In addition to weather changes, seasonal debris such as leaves or pollen can accumulate in drains. This organic material can decompose and produce foul smells if not washed away. Regular maintenance becomes crucial as the seasons shift to prevent these natural processes from leading to more serious plumbing issues and odours.

Identifying Bad Smells Early

Detecting unpleasant odours emanating from drains is crucial for maintaining a healthy home environment. A foul smell often indicates underlying problems that can escalate if left unaddressed. Homeowners should be vigilant for signs like a rotten egg scent, which can suggest the presence of sulphur gas, or a musty smell that may indicate mould growth within the plumbing system. Recognising these indicators early allows for timely intervention, potentially saving costly repairs and extensive cleaning.

Regular inspections of drains can help catch bad smells before they become overwhelming. Homeowners should pay attention to changes in odour intensity following rainfall or heavy usage. If the familiar scent of waste begins to linger, it is an unmistakable signal that the drainage system requires immediate evaluation. Taking swift action can often mitigate larger issues related to blockages or leaks, preserving the integrity of both the plumbing infrastructure and the home’s overall hygiene.

Signs Your Drains Need Immediate Attention

Unpleasant odours emanating from drains are often the first indication of underlying problems. If you notice a persistent foul smell, it could signal trapped debris or stagnant water that requires urgent attention. Gurgling sounds while using fixtures may also suggest a blockage, disrupting the normal flow of wastewater. These auditory signs can be an early warning indicating that your drainage system is not functioning as intended.

Slow drainage often indicates a build-up of materials within the pipes, which can lead to severe clogs. An unusual increase in insects or pests around drainage areas may also point to organic decay in the drains, necessitating professional help. Being vigilant about these signs not only helps maintain hygiene but can also prevent costly repairs.
